Read more– opens a dialog boxEach review score is between 1–10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We're currently testing a weighted review system in Malta and Iceland (excluding hotel and vacation rental chains). For properties in these countries, the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ate "subscores" in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money, and free Wifi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

United States of AmericaIt was impossible the contact the front desk from an outside line and the company’s online chat sent us in a hilarious endless loop. There is room for improvement. The property seemed to try to keep up, but on a busy weekend, the guest litter would be understandably difficult to manage. Guests left litter, like soda cups, in stairwells, bags of half eaten food in hallways, and at the indoor waterpark, many many trays of food were left about the walls. Several sets of guests left dirty shoes on chairs to save a place. The breakfast buffet was passable. Some plates in the stack appeared dirty. One had a fruit sticker affixed. The buffet is in a ballroom in the basement. Also, therr were consistently vehicles idling in front ofnthe entry doors, lending car exhaust to the air in the lobby. Perhaps this could be managed via “no idling” signs or better traffic management.
The indoor waterpark was perfect for kids. The professionalism of the lifeguard staff and routine was notably impressive. The staff was friendly.

CanadaSome parts of the water park were a bit injury prone for kids and adults alike, due to the materials used. Scraped feet and knees in the lazy river and kiddie pool were an issue for the whole family. We ended up fully dressing the 2yo to prevent further scrapes due to crawling around. While the breakfast buffet was good, the lunch and dinner buffets were disappointing both times we tried it. Prices at the snack bar in the water park as well as the restaurant next to it were high, but that was in line with our expectations. The rooms can be noisy at times, despite the recommended quiet time between 11 pm and 7 am. Doors and floors transfer the noise well.
The accommodations were good. The room was comfortable, with an extra crib for our 2yo provided by the resort.
